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it e5aa4699 authored by Mady Mellor's avatar Mady Mellor Committed by Automerger Merge Worker
Browse files

Merge "Fix colors in bubble settings so they're more visible" into udc-dev am:...

Merge "Fix colors in bubble settings so they're more visible" into udc-dev am: 8a478993 am: 7605e122

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23607273



Change-Id: I616264cebad588f95f8c1756e81bca62927ddbb9
Signed-off-by: default avatarAutomer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
parents 8f3679ab 7605e122
Loading
Loading
Loading
Loading
+5 −2
Original line number Diff line number Diff line
@@ -15,9 +15,12 @@
  limitations under the License.
  -->
<shape xmlns:android="http://schemas.android.com/apk/res/android"
       xmlns:androidprv="http://schemas.android.com/apk/prv/res/android"
       android:shape="rectangle">
    <solid
        android:color="?androidprv:attr/materialColorPrimaryContainer" />
    <stroke
        android:width="2dp"
        android:color="?android:attr/colorAccent"/>
        android:width="1dp"
        android:color="?androidprv:attr/materialColorOnPrimaryContainer"/>
    <corners android:radius="@dimen/rect_button_radius" />
</shape>
+2 −2
Original line number Diff line number Diff line
@@ -15,10 +15,10 @@
  limitations under the License.
  -->
<shape xmlns:android="http://schemas.android.com/apk/res/android"
       xmlns:androidprv="http://schemas.android.com/apk/prv/res/android"
       android:shape="rectangle">
    <stroke
        android:width="1dp"
        android:color="?android:attr/colorAccent"/>

        android:color="?androidprv:attr/materialColorOutlineVariant"/>
    <corners android:radius="@dimen/rect_button_radius" />
</shape>
+4 −3
Original line number Diff line number Diff line
@@ -167,9 +167,10 @@ public class BubblePreference extends Preference implements View.OnClickListener
                : R.drawable.button_border_unselected));
            mView.setSelected(selected);

            ColorStateList stateList = selected
                    ? Utils.getColorAccent(context)
                    : Utils.getColorAttr(context, android.R.attr.textColorPrimary);
            int colorResId = selected
                    ? com.android.internal.R.attr.materialColorOnPrimaryContainer
                    : com.android.internal.R.attr.materialColorOnSurfaceVariant;
            ColorStateList stateList = Utils.getColorAttr(context, colorResId);
            mImageView.setImageTintList(stateList);
            mTextView.setTextColor(stateList);
        }